KL06, LK06 og LK20 – hva er greia??? - Utdanningsdirektoratet/KL06-LK20-public GitHub Wiki

Denne siden er en del av Ofte stilte spørsmål

Spørsmål:

"_I den versjonen vi har brukt tidligere, v201802, har pathen vært https://data.udir.no/kl06..._ _Nå med fagfornyelsen og v201906, forventet jeg den skulle være noe med https://data.udir.no/lk20_ men den er fortsatt /kl06. Hvorfor er det slik?"

Svar:

For å svare på dette, må vi først ty til litt historikk.

Helt i starten, da vi utviklet dette API-et for læreplaner og kodeverk som ble lansert i 2006, lå det an til at den offisielle forkortelsen for Kunnskapsløftet skulle være KL06. Både direktoratet og departementet brukte KL06 (Kunnskapsløftet 2006) helt i starten. Derfor valgte vi å bruke dette i stien. Men en tid etter lansering, og etter at våre databrukere allerede hadde begynt å skrive mot API-ene våre, ble dette endret til LK06 (Læreplaner for Kunnskapsløftet 2006). Da mente vi det var for sent å endre dette i pathen/stien/URLen - det ville ført til at alle som bruker data fra oss måtte skrive om sine systemer.

Men, etter hvert har vi tenkt at dette slett ikke er så galt til at det ikke er godt for noe. Læreplanverket for Kunnskapsløftet inneholder mer enn det vi har digitalisert i Grep, og Grep på sin side inneholder mer en det som strengt tatt er en del av læreplanverket. For eksempel er ikke Overordnet del (tidl. Generell del) en del av Grep, og vi i Grep står friere til å lage konstruksjoner som f.eks. Opplæringsfag og Kompetansemålsett for å binde sammen elementer i den offisielle strukturen.

Konklusjon så lagt:

data.udir.no/kl06 inneholder LK06-elementer.

Så kom fagfornyelsen:

Da vi skulle innlemme fagfornyelsen i Grep, hadde vi selvsagt noen valg. Vi kunne f.eks. la data.udir.no/kl06 leve sitt eget liv, og på den måten være historie arkivert i /kl06. Men husk for det første at fagfornyelsen ikke er en ny læreplanreform, men en revidering av Kunnskapsløftet. For det andre har vi gradvis innføring av læreplaner for ulike årstrinn for noen av læreplanene, og det gjør at vi må ivareta overgangsordninger. I tillegg er det mange elementer som fortsatt gjelder for både LK06 og LK20, f.eks fagkoder og det vi kaller tilbudsstrukturen (utdanningsprogram og programområder). Derfor valgte vi å la LK06 og LK20 leve side om side i /kl06.

Konklusjon så langt:

data.udir.no/kl06 inneholder både LK06- og LK20-elementer.

Tunga rett i munnen:

Vi er klar over at dette fører til at databrukerne våre da må holde tunga mer rett i munnen. På den andre siden har vi da også et komplett datasett som også har med seg historikken, noe som er nyttig i mange sammenhenger. Det er for eksempel enkelt å bla seg tilbake fra en gjeldende læreplan, og se hva som gjaldt i 2014. De fleste elementene har metadata som gyldig-fra/gyldig-til, foerste-semester/siste-semester, men også statusinformasjon som publisert/utgaatt osv. som det da er viktig å ta høyde for når vi bruker data fra Grep. Det sikrer at du alltid opererer med gjeldende og oppdaterte data. Og du finner alt på ett sted.

Bildet nedenfor illustrerer forholdet mellom LK06- og LK20-innhold som du finner i /kl06/v201906: Illustrasjon: forholdet mellom LK06- og LK20-innhold som du finner i /kl06/v201906